Cosmetic Girls — Incredible Portraits Stress the Relationship between Korean Girls and Beauty










Much different from the Russian teenage girls we’ve seen yesterday in Olya Ivanova’s series Weirdo are the Korean girls in these outstanding portraits by photographer Hein-Kuhn Oh from the series Cosmetic Girls.
With tidier haircuts, more understated but no less heavy make-up and no tattoos, these girls seem to strive to look older than they actually are; but what strikes the most are their stiff poses and near lifelessness. More than adolescents, these teenage girls look like dolls, or even worse, robots.
